The Garnet Guard
The Garnet Guard, founded in 1988, is made up of all alumni/ae who have celebrated their 50th ReUnion. Members of the 50th ReUnion class are welcomed into the Garnet Guard at their 50th ReUnion during the Medallion Ceremony. Currently there are two annual luncheons held on campus for the Garnet Guard: one during Homecoming and Family Weekend, the second during ReUnion Weekend.

Garnet Guard Lifetime Pass
All Members of the Garnet Guard are issued a Garnet Guard Lifetime Pass. This pass entitles members to:
- Use of the Alumni Gym
- Use of the Schaffer Library
- Free admission to Union home athletic contests (excludes hockey and post-season tournaments).
- A 15% discount at the College Bookstore on any item on the purchase of any item which carries the name or emblem of UNION COLLEGE (excludes class rings)
